Output 2599243dd256311205e73513b6297a61e0bacdbc3c2019f85238094d4655366f:0

value
133904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ffc7db924cc90905fe7252699fe19b437b86608 OP_EQUAL
address
34c9LszyfTHUxnu9TdfDLk4qRsKE8gxnuR
transaction
2599243dd256311205e73513b6297a61e0bacdbc3c2019f85238094d4655366f
spent
true